What are Downpipes?
Downpipes Near Me, likewise called rainwater pipes or vertical pipelines, are installed as part of a structure's drainage system. They collect rainwater from roof gutters and transportation it downwards to designated drainage areas, such as storm drains pipes. Downpipes can be made from numerous materials, including:

The significance of appropriate downpipe installations can not be overstated. They contribute to numerous vital functional and aesthetic benefits, including:

Preventing Water Damage: Downpipes guarantee that rainwater is efficiently transported away, decreasing the threat of dampness and rot in the foundation and walls.

Erosion Control: By directing rains into approved drainage systems, downpipes help protect the surrounding landscape from soil disintegration.

Safeguarding Landscaping: Properly installed downpipes can assist channel water away from flower beds, gardens, and yards, preserving the looks and health of your outside area.

Structure Longevity: With efficient drainage systems in location, downpipes aid extend the lifespan of your structure by decreasing the wear and tear triggered by inappropriate water management.

How often should downpipes be maintained?
Routine maintenance is important. It's advised to have actually downpipes examined a minimum of as soon as a year, especially after heavy rains, to look for obstructions or damage.
Can I install downpipes myself?
While some property owners with DIY experience may go with self-installation, it's often best to work with professionals. Incorrect installation can cause drainage issues and increased repair expenses.
How do I know if my downpipes require to be replaced?
Indications your downpipes may need replacement consist of visible rust or damage, leakages, and inefficient drainage leading to water pooling around the foundation.
Exist developing codes for downpipes?
Yes, lots of towns have particular building codes regarding the installation of downpipes. It's vital to inspect local guidelines to guarantee compliance.
